>We adopt C base types, and C structure syntax. THE HORROR! THE HORROR! C type declarations are pretty universally despised. And why do you want to get so unnaturally chummy with the machine? That seems pretty hamstringly. In Class::Struct there's already a more perlish way of doing "struct"s. Now, if all you want to do is make it easier to get at packed binary C data structures, that's a different matter. I did this for perl4 using c2ph. A more revised mechanism that makes more perl5ish sense could be devised--in fact, I've made proposals about that, back quite some time ago. As Larry has said, "If you want to program in C, then program in C. It's a nice language -- I use it now and then." --tom
